Nonstick pans could be produced out of numerous sorts of base content, that may assistance identify how properly your pan conducts, maintains, and responds to warmth. The lightest and most favored of those is aluminum, which conducts heat nicely and can be used on a variety of cooktops. Chrome steel is an additional popular preference—these pans tend to be heavier, with additional significant thickness making them considerably less susceptible to dings and dents.
